Not right now unfortunately, I am still in the process of adding the package on Conda.
Even if you are using anaconda, you can still do pip install pyprocessmacro
and use it without any issue. Let me know if you encounter a problem!
I have now uploaded pyprocessmacro to conda. You should now be able to install it using conda install pyprocessmacro -c conda-forge
